Tempest Storm prepares for her 88th birthday while reflecting on her long career as an exotic dancer in the United States. She faces a personal challenge as she seeks to reconcile with her daughter, Patricia, after five decades of estrangement. The film documents their attempts to mend their relationship, revealing themes of motherhood and regret against the backdrop of Storm's glamorous yet troubled life. Directed by Nimisha Mukerji, the documentary runs for 82 minutes.
